Barbara Gillespie

                Mrs. Barbara Barker Gillespie, age 86, formerly of Covington, died Sunday, November 28, 2010, at Richfield Recovery & Care Center, Salem.  She was the wife of the late A.E. Gillespie, Jr.

                Mrs. Gillespie was born February 11, 1924 in Boone County, WV, the daughter of the late Stonewall J. Barker and Ella Maude Barker.  She was employed as a cosmetologist and bookkeeper for the former A & P as well as Kroger.  She was a member of Covington Baptist Church and the Fellowship Sunday School Class.  Mrs. Gillespie was a member of the Good Hope Rebekah Lodge #8 where she served as president of Western Rebekah Assn #10 and president of Rebekah Assembly for 1987 and 1988.

                Mrs. Gillespie is survived by three grandchildren, Jason Gillespie, Jessica Gillespie, and Megan Gillespie, all of Largo, FL; one brother, Stonie Barker of Naples, FL; a sister-in-law, Ileita Gillespie Weikle of Covington; and a number of nieces and nephews.

                In addition to her parents, Stonewall J. Barker and Ella Maude Barker, and her husband, A.E. Gillespie, Jr., Mrs. Gillespie was preceded in death by a son, Charles Wayne Gillespie; an infant daughter; one brother, Oather Ray Barker; and four sisters, Melba Beckett, Vada Redmond, Esta Maires and Sada Atkins.
